Main highlights of the system

Smart Stop-Loss System: Capital protection with verifiable logic

The heart of the risk management approach on the platform is to maintain the initial capital at a controllable level Before considering returns

Working mechanism

The system continuously tracks the difference in portfolio value against the most recent high (drawdown) as it approaches a pre-defined threshold. The algorithm estimates the speed of price changes and trading volume together. To separate normal fluctuations from significant reversal signals.

When risk conditions are confirmed by multiple variables simultaneously The system will execute the loss limit orders set by the user. without having to wait for confirmation from the user at that time This reduces the delays that often result from emotional decisions.

The results obtained

Users do not need to watch the screen all the time to prevent severe losses. Protection thresholds are predetermined according to the individual's risk tolerance. This allows port management to continue. Even when users are outside of the market time zone or do not have immediate access to the Internet.

The goal of this system is to keep existing capital available for the next round of opportunities. Rather than trying to capture the market's timing as accurately as possible.

Frequently asked questions

Technical and security concerns

The answer below explains the factual mechanism of how the system works. with no guarantee of returns

How is user information treated?

User account and port information is stored and transmitted over an encrypted connection. Access to data within the system is restricted to only those processes necessary for analysis and display to the user.

How does the platform connect to your account or trading system?

The connection is made through a channel that supports limited permissions. Users can specify that the system only has permission to read data for analysis. or allow actions to be taken according to the set Stop-Loss conditions.

How accurate are AI models?

Forecast models estimate probabilities. It is not a prediction of an exact outcome. Accuracy varies with market conditions and data period used. The system is therefore designed to work with risk management mechanisms such as Smart Stop-Loss to limit the impact in the event of incorrect forecasts.
